Coneyhurst, a Grade II listed building project with the main objective to sympathetically refurbish the existing 16th century heritage asset and to build a 21st century extension to help meet the requirements of family living.


We were pleased to learn that our design for the contemporary extension was awarded the Small Residential Award at the Sussex Heritage Trust Awards 2021.


Employing our 'Integrated Approach' to architecture and planning, which incorporates the principles of Constructive Conservation and an evidence-based method, Douglas Briggs Partnership crafted the design and secured Planning and Listed Building Consent for a significant 'linked extension.'


This extension offers a modern kitchen living area and guest accommodation for the residents, featuring an articulated cumbrian slate roof design that compliments the Horsham stone roof of the 16th century timber-framed house without overshadowing its historical structure and significance.
